Mesothelioma

Mesothelioma is a type of cancer that affects the thin layer of tissue that surrounds organs in the body. It is usually caused by exposure to asbestos, a material widely used in industrial processes. Asbestos-related victims may be entitled compensation from the companies that exposed them to the harmful substance. A skilled Chicago mesothelioma lawyer can assist victims receive the compensation they deserve.

Mesothelioma often develops in the layers tissue that cover each lung (the pleura). However, it may also start in the peritoneum, which is the thick membrane that protects the organs of the stomach. Mesothelioma symptoms can include discomfort in the chest or belly and breathing difficulties and coughing, as well as fever. The disease is usually diagnosed by a doctor who runs a physical exam and then records a patient's medical history. A patient's physician may order a chest X-ray or CT scan to detect mesothelioma-related signs, such as lung inflammation or the formation of plaques of the pleural.

asbestos attorney exposure in military bases

In all branches of the military, asbestos was used for a long time because it was sturdy and fireproof as well as is a good insulator. Asbestos was used extensively in the on-base buildings, ships and aircrafts. Asbestos fibres were inhaled by people when asbestos was disturbed during renovation or installation work. Veterans from all branches of the military are at risk of exposure to asbestos which can cause illnesses like mesothelioma or lung cancer.

Army bases tended to have less asbestos than Navy and Air Force bases, but there were plenty of exposure opportunities for soldiers. Army bases had asbestos in the roofing, flooring and cement of their buildings. It was also found in bedding, in the insulation of walls and ceilings and in gaskets and clutch plates as well as brakes on vehicles. Infantrymen of the Army were particularly at risk of exposure because they often worked in motor pools repairing and maintaining transport vehicles of all types.

The same applies to members of the Merchant Marine who ferried cargo as well as passengers during the war and peace times. Asbestos was present on their vessels in boiler rooms, pipes, steam lines, heaters, valves and gaskets. Merchant Marine workers were also exposed to asbestos case when they repaired and dismantled vehicles of the armed forces.
